拉取相关依赖
dnf -y install dnf-plugins-core
设置阿里云镜像库
dnf config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o
安装docker
dnf install docker-ce docker-ce-cli containerd.io docker-buildx-plugin docker-compose-plugin
设置docker镜像加速
# 创建目录
mkdir -p /etc/docker
# 写入配置文件
sudo tee /etc/docker/daemon.json <<-'EOF'
{"registry-mirrors": ["https://docker-0.unsee.tech","https://docker-cf.registry.cyou","https://docker.1panel.live"]
}
EOF
# 重启docker服务
sudo systemctl daemon-reload && sudo systemctl restart docker
测试
ping -c 3 docker-0.unsee.tech
删除docker
#删除docker
dnf remove docker-ce docker-ce-cli containerd.io docker-buildx-plugin docker-compose-plugin
尾声:如果docker镜像加速地址失效了,可以通过Docker镜像加速列表去获取最新的